5'-O-(tert-butyldimethylsilyl)-3'-O-(6-maleimidohexanoyl)thymidine | 1426954-32-6

中文名称
——
中文别名
——
英文名称
5'-O-(tert-butyldimethylsilyl)-3'-O-(6-maleimidohexanoyl)thymidine
英文别名
[(2R,3S,5R)-2-[[tert-butyl(dimethyl)silyl]oxymethyl]-5-(5-methyl-2,4-dioxopyrimidin-1-yl)oxolan-3-yl] 6-(2,5-dioxopyrrol-1-yl)hexanoate
5'-O-(tert-butyldimethylsilyl)-3'-O-(6-maleimidohexanoyl)thymidine化学式
CAS
1426954-32-6
化学式
C26H39N3O8Si
mdl
——
分子量
549.696
InChiKey
CTSMFVMZCPDJCB-NNMXDRDESA-N
BEILSTEIN
——
EINECS
——

  • 作为产物:
    描述:
    6-马来酰亚胺基己酸5’-O-(叔丁基二甲基甲硅烷基)胸苷4-二甲氨基吡啶N,N'-二环己基碳二亚胺 作用下, 以 二氯甲烷 为溶剂, 反应 24.0h, 以20%的产率得到5'-O-(tert-butyldimethylsilyl)-3'-O-(6-maleimidohexanoyl)thymidine

文献信息

  • Fluorogenic Diels–Alder reactions of novel phencyclone derivatives
    作者:Engin Aytac Aydin、Hans-Josef Altenbach
    DOI:10.1016/j.tetlet.2013.01.095
    日期:2013.4
    With the aim of obtaining fluorogenic Diels-Alder reactions, novel phencyclone derivatives were synthesized. In a short time and under convenient reaction conditions, the formation of Diels-Alder adducts was observed by color-change and up to 33-fold enhancement of fluorescence. The modification of thymidine and deoxycytidine derivatives with a maleimide side chain and their usage in fluorogenic Diels-Alder reaction is also reported. (C) 2013 Elsevier Ltd.
